Understanding The Cost Of Carbon Offsets Per Ton

Carbon offsets have become an increasingly popular tool in the fight against climate change. By purchasing carbon offsets, individuals and companies can mitigate the greenhouse gas emissions they produce by supporting projects that reduce emissions elsewhere. These projects can range from renewable energy initiatives to reforestation efforts, and they all work to offset the carbon emissions that contribute to global warming.

One key aspect of carbon offsets that often attracts attention is the cost per ton of carbon offset. This metric provides insight into the financial implications of offsetting carbon emissions and can help individuals and businesses understand the economic impact of their environmental efforts. In this article, we explore the factors that influence the cost of carbon offsets per ton and delve into the importance of this metric in the broader context of climate change mitigation.

The cost of carbon offsets per ton can vary widely depending on a variety of factors. One of the primary determinants of cost is the nature of the offset project itself. Projects that require significant upfront investment, such as building a solar farm or implementing carbon capture technology, are likely to have higher costs per ton compared to simpler initiatives like planting trees. Additionally, the location of the project can impact cost, as projects in regions with higher labor or material costs may be more expensive to implement.

Another crucial factor that influences the cost of carbon offsets per ton is the quality of the offset itself. High-quality offsets are those that result in legitimate and verifiable emissions reductions, often through rigorous certification processes like the Gold Standard or Verified Carbon Standard. These certifications attest to the environmental integrity of the offset and ensure that the emissions reductions are real and permanent. As a result, high-quality offsets typically command higher prices due to the additional assurance they provide to buyers.

Market dynamics also play a significant role in determining the cost of carbon offsets per ton. The price of offsets is influenced by supply and demand dynamics in the carbon offset market, which can fluctuate based on factors like regulatory changes, investor interest, and global economic conditions. As demand for carbon offsets increases, prices may rise as suppliers seek to capitalize on the growing market opportunity. Conversely, a surplus of offsets in the market can drive prices down as sellers compete for buyers.
